Background: We aimed to evaluate the comparative efficacy and safety of anti–vascular endothelial growth factor (anti-VEGF) monotherapy to identify its utilization and prioritization in patients with neovascular age-related macular degeneration (nAMD).Methods: Eligible studies included randomized controlled trials comparing the recommended anti-VEGF agents (ranibizumab, bevacizumab, aflibercept, brolucizumab, and conbercept) under various therapeutic regimens. Outcomes of interest included the mean change in best-corrected visual acuity (BCVA), serious adverse events, the proportion of patients who gained ≥15 letters or lost <15 letters in BCVA, the mean change in central retinal thickness, and the number of injections within 12 months.Results: Twenty-seven trials including 10,484 participants and eighteen treatments were identified in the network meta-analysis. The aflibercept 2 mg bimonthly, ranibizumab 0.5 mg T&E, and brolucizumab 6 mg q12w/q8w regimens had better visual efficacy. Brolucizumab had absolute superiority in anatomical outcomes and a relative advantage of safety, as well as good performance of aflibercept 2 mg T&E. The proactive regimens had slightly better efficacy but a slightly increased number of injections versus the reactive regimen. Bevacizumab had a statistically non-significant trend toward a lower degree of efficacy and safety.Conclusion: The visual efficacy of four individual anti-VEGF drugs is comparable. Several statistically significant differences were observed considering special anti-VEGF regimens, suggesting that brolucizumab 6 mg q12w/q8w, aflibercept 2 mg bimonthly or T&E, and ranibizumab 0.5 mg T&E are the ideal anti-VEGF regimens for nAMD patients. In the current landscape, based on the premise of equivalent efficacy and safety, the optimal choice of anti-VEGF monotherapies seems mandatory to obtain maximal benefit.

AimsTo evaluate outcome of anti-vascular endothelial growth factor (VEGF) therapy for the treatment of neovascular age-related macular degeneration (nAMD) in the real-life setting and to compare incidence of ocular serious adverse events (SAE) after injections administered by nurses and physicians.MethodsRetrospective, single-centre study. Medical records of patients receiving anti-VEGF treatment for nAMD between 2008 and 2013 with three-loading-dose regimen were evaluated. Outcome measures were baseline visual acuity (VA), change in VA, number of intravitreal injections, incidence of ocular SAE and patients’ baseline characteristics affecting VA change. In addition, the number of injections per 1000 citizens living in the serving area and per individuals over 65 years old were estimated.Results1349 eyes in 1117 patients received a total of 11 562 intravitreal anti-VEGF injections. Twenty-one per cent of patients received treatment for both eyes. The mean baseline Snellen VA was 0.32. The mean change of VA from baseline was +2, +2 and ±0 Early Treatment Diabetic Retinopathy Study letters and the mean numbers of injections were 5.7, 4.7 and 4.9 at years 1, 2 and 3, respectively. There was a negative correlation between baseline VA and change of VA. Incidence of endophthalmitis was 0.086%. No difference in the incidence of ocular SAE was identified between injections given by nurses or by physicians. The number of intravitreal injections per all citizens was 9 per 1000 inhabitants and 45 per 1000 inhabitants over 65 years.ConclusionThe VA was maintained at the baseline level (±0 letters) with the mean of 15.3 anti-VEGF injections in real-world clinical practice during 3-year follow-up.

Purpose: The aim of this study was to determine whether multiple intravitreal injections of anti-vascular endothelial growth factor (VEGF) drugs for age-related macular degeneration (AMD) exacerbate systemic arteriosclerosis, using the cardio-ankle vascular index (CAVI) and intima-media thickness (IMT). Methods: We analyzed the data of 45 AMD patients who received intravitreal injections of anti-VEGF drugs (ranibizumab and/or aflibercept) and underwent systemic evaluations at baseline and after treatment. Reevaluation was conducted at ≥12 months from the initial treatment. Results: The total number of intravitreal injections of overall anti-VEGF drugs was significantly correlated with Δserum cystatin C. The cumulative number of aflibercept injections was identified as an independent protective factor for ΔCAVI. An increase in the cumulative number of intravitreal injections of overall anti-VEGF drugs was identified as a protective factor for Δmean IMT. Conclusion: Repeated intravitreal injections of an anti-VEGF drug for AMD may lead to morphological and functional changes in large arteries.

Purpose: To identify outpatient treatment patterns of patients with exudative age-related macular degeneration (AMD) who received approved anti–vascular endothelial growth factor (VEGF) therapy, using real-world data from hospitals in Japan. Methods: A hospital claims database was retrospectively reviewed for patients diagnosed with exudative AMD who were treated with anti-VEGF therapy in the outpatient setting between January 2010 and December 2012. Within a treatment period of at least 12 months, the frequency of anti-VEGF injections and AMD-related visits, and time intervals between AMD-related visits and anti-VEGF injections were captured for patients who had neither cataracts nor glaucoma. “Loading dose regimen” was defined as the first 2 or 3 monthly doses and “PRN maintenance regimen” (where PRN=pro re nata) was defined as the entire period of time after the loading doses had been administered. Results: Claims data were collected from a total of 219 patients from 13 of 126 hospitals: 217 treated with ranibizumab (8 received pegaptanib as well), 2 with aflibercept. Of these, 68 patients were treated for at least 12 months (all with ranibizumab PRN), and 29 had neither cataracts nor glaucoma and were included in the treatment pattern analysis. These 29 patients received a mean of 3.8 injections in the first 12 months and another 2.5 injections in the second 12 months of treatment. The average number of all outpatient visits was 16.1 in the first 12 months and 13.7 in the second 12 months, and an average of 11.6 days elapsed between injections and the previous outpatient monitoring visits using a PRN schedule. Conclusion: In a real-world setting in Japan, anti-VEGF PRN injections are administered less frequently than in clinical trials, and with time between monitoring and re-injection visits. Nonetheless, patients still visit the hospital frequently, which can significantly burden patients, caregivers, and healthcare providers.

Purpose To evaluate the efficacy of intravitreal anti-vascular endothelial growth factor (anti-VEGF) agents for treatment of neovascular age-related macular degeneration (nAMD) in vitrectomized eyes. Methods The medical records were reviewed of nAMD patients treated with anti-VEGF agents who previously underwent pars plana vitrectomy (PPV). PPV was performed with complete posterior vitreous detachment induction. Results A total of 44 eyes from 44 patients were included. The mean central foveal thickness (CFT) was 478.50 ± 156.93 μm at baseline, 414.25 ± 143.55 μm (86.6% of baseline) at 1 month after first injection (P < 0.001), and 386.75 ± 141.45 μm (80.8% of baseline) after monthly multiple injections (2.30 ± 1.07; range, 1–5) (P < 0.001). The mean logarithm of the minimum angle of resolution best-corrected visual acuity visual acuity (BCVA) was 0.85 ± 0.57 at baseline, 0.86 ± 0.63 after the first injection, and 0.84 ± 0.64 after monthly multiple injections. BCVA improved in 39.5% at 1 month after first injection and 45.2% at 1 month after monthly multiple injections. In the subgroup analysis, CFT of eyes with the posterior capsule decreased significantly to 85.8% and 79.8% of baseline values at 1 month after the first injection and after monthly multiple injections, respectively. CFT of eyes without the posterior capsule decreased to 91.6% and 87.4% of baseline values at 1 month after the first injection and after monthly multiple injections, respectively, without statistical significance. Conclusion Monthly injections of Intravitreal anti-VEGF agents induced favorable anatomical improvement and vision maintenance in vitrectomized eyes with nAMD.

AimsTo demonstrate and evaluate the morphological changes of multilayered fibrovascular pigment epithelial detachment (PED) to a single anti-vascular endothelial growth factor (VEGF) injection in age-related macular degeneration (AMD).MethodsWe retrospectively analysed the morphological changes of 30 eyes with exudative AMD showing fibrotic multilayered PED, between two consecutive visits. All patients had one anti-VEGF intravitreal injection at the first visit. We quantitatively analysed the different compartments within the PED and their morphological response.ResultsThe mean follow-up time interval between the first and the second visit was 32.46±4.64 days. We defined three optical coherence tomography zones within the PED: a subretinal pigment epithelium inhomogeneous hyporeflective space (layer 1), a hyper-reflective band beneath layer 1 (layer 2), and a hyporeflective space between the Bruch’s membrane and layer 2 (layer 3). The mean height of layer 1 was 142±44.63 and 99.30±39.79 µm at visits 1 and 2, respectively. The mean thickness of layer 2 was 101.42±46.66 and 82.76±35.24 µm at visits 1 and 2, respectively. The mean height of layer 3 was 35.77±32.77 and 5.66±8.68 µm at visits 1 and 2, respectively (p=0.009). The mean height change for layer 1 was statistically significantly higher than for layer 2 (p=0.0002).ConclusionsFibrovascular PED was compartmented into three layers with different reflectivities that morphologically responded differently to a single anti-VEGF injection. Layer 2 had a statistically significantly lower response compared with layer 1, suggesting the hypothesis of a fibrotic component in layer 2.

Background: Compare the current indications for intravitreal anti-vascular endothelial growth factor (anti-VEGF) therapy, to make recommendations for planning of services. To review the current indications for intravitreal anti-vascular endothelial growth factor (anti-VEGF) therapy, in order to make recommendations for planning of services.Methods: The medical records of 172 patients who had intravitreal anti-vascular endothelial growth factor (anti-VEGF) injections from January 2016 to December 2019 were retrieved. Socio-demographic and clinical data were extracted, analysed, and compared with data from the previously published audit report covering 2010 to 2012.Results: Three hundred and thirty injections were given to 182 eyes in this cohort of patients. The mean age was 61.1±16.3 years (range <1-90 years), with a male to female ratio of 1.1:1. Retinal vein occlusion, 64 (35%) remained the most common indication for anti-VEGF injections in the eyes treated. This was followed by choroidal neovascular membrane/wet age-related macular degeneration which accounted for 42 (23%) as reported previously. However, cases of proliferative diabetic retinopathy/ diabetic maculopathy needing anti-VEGF were noticed to have almost doubled from about 8 (10%) in the previous study to 15 (27%) in the present study. In addition, idiopathic polypoidal choroidal vasculopathy, 18 (10%) ranked above proliferative sickle cell retinopathy in the present study. Retinopathy of prematurity (ROP), neovascular glaucoma, retinal artery macro-aneurysm and myopic choroidal neovascular membrane were the new emerging indications.Conclusion: There is an expanding indication for anti-VEGF in the management of retinal vascular diseases in the health facility and adequate measures should be put in place for early diagnosis and management. Patients should be counselled on the availability of this treatment option.

Abstract Purpose: To study long-term clinical outcomes in patients with submacular hemorrhage (SMH) and/or vitreous hemorrhage (VH) associated with neovascular age-related macular degeneration (nAMD), who received pars plana vitrectomy (PPV) followed by anti-vascular endothelial growth factor (VEGF) therapy.Methods: In this retrospective case series, 25 eyes with SMH and/or VH associated with nAMD were treated by PPV and followed for at least 24 months. When exudative changes were unresolved or recurred after PPV, additional intravitreal anti-VEGF therapy was given. Results:Mean best-corrected visual acuity (BCVA) of all patients improved significantly at 1, 3, 6, 12, 18 and 24 months (P<0.01) post-PPV and at the final visit (P<0.05). Mean BCVA of 13 eyes with anti-VEGF therapy improved significantly at 1 (P<0.05), 3, 6, 12 (P<0.01), 18 and 24 months (P<0.05), while 12 eyes without anti-VEGF therapy improved at 1, 3 and 6 months (P<0.05) only. Average duration from initial PPV to anti-VEGF therapy initiation was 7.54±9.9 months. Five of 13 eyes (38.5%) with anti-VEGF therapy maintained dry macula for more than 1 year after the last injection. Conclusions: In patients with SMH and VH caused by nAMD, administering intravitreal anti-VEGF therapy when exudative changes are unresolved or recur after PPV maintains improved visual acuity long term.

We investigated the factors associated with the discontinuation of anti-vascular endothelial growth factor (VEGF) therapies in patients with neovascular age-related macular degeneration (AMD). Japanese patients with AMD aged ≥50 years, reporting at least one prior injection of an anti-VEGF drug, completed an online survey covering reasons for discontinuation or dissatisfaction with therapy, quality of life (EQ-5D-5L) and patient activation (PAM-13). The respondents were divided into two cohorts: Cohort 1—patients who discontinued anti-VEGF therapy (n = 207); Cohort 2—patients continuing anti-VEGF therapy (n = 65). The most common reason for discontinuing therapy was the “doctor’s decision” in 89.4% (Cohort 1-1). In the other 22 (10.6%) patients in Cohort 1 (Cohort 1-2), reasons included “no deterioration in vision”, “financial burden” and “ineffective treatment”. Patients in Cohort 2 were dissatisfied with “long waiting times” (77%), “financial burden” and “ineffective treatment”. Pain/discomfort posed the greatest impact on quality of life. Only 5% of patients in Cohorts 1-1 and 2 and none in Cohort 1-2 were considered advocates for their own health. In conclusion, most patients who discontinued anti-VEGF therapy did so at their doctor’s decision. Addressing the reasons associated with discontinuation or dissatisfaction with anti-VEGF therapies might help improve their continuation.
